Load Shedding and One Approach in CBAS

  As I’m sure you know, power companies charge a premium when a certain demand threshold is reached. Load shedding during high electrical demand periods is a good way to lower electrical consumption and avoid paying premium prices for exceeding peak demand limits. Computrols Takes on Two Teletrol Integrations

Computrols has begun working on two integration projects to Teletrol HVAC controls systems. The first project is located at 24 Waterway Avenue in The Woodlands, TX and the second is at 400 Oceangate in Long Beach, CA.
